Hard Rock Las Vegas Construction Update - August 2026
Las Vegas - August 1, 2026
Nearly two months after the Hard Rock Guitar Hotel reached its full structural height, the project has entered a visibly accelerated phase of exterior and interior build-out. The resort's transformation from the former Mirage into Hard Rock Las Vegas is now unmistakable across the Strip skyline, with new facade sections, LED lighting hardware, and round-the-clock construction activity marking the first major progress since the topping-off milestone.
Facade Installation Now Climbing the Tower
The most prominent change since early June is the rapid rise of the blue-glass exterior panels. Crews are installing two distinct shades of blue-one deeper, one lighter-to create the Hard Rock guitar's signature body and "string" tones. These panels now cover multiple vertical bands on the lower and mid-tower floors, giving the structure its first true visual identity.
The facade work is advancing in stacked sections, with new glass added almost daily. From street level, the tower's curvature and guitar profile are becoming increasingly defined as the enclosure climbs higher.
LED Guitar-String System Installation Begins
A major milestone in July is the start of installation for the LED guitar-string lighting system. Mounting hardware is now visible along the tower's front face, marking the first steps toward the illuminated strings that will run the full height of the building.
This system is expected to become one of the Strip's most recognizable nighttime features once activated, similar to the Hard Rock Guitar Hotel in Florida but scaled for Las Vegas.
Interior Build-Out Accelerates Across the Property
Inside the Guitar Tower, construction has transitioned into the mechanical, electrical, and plumbing (MEP) phase. Guest-room framing is underway, with crews working floor-by-floor to build out corridors, service cores, and room layouts.
Meanwhile, the former Mirage resort structures are undergoing a full interior redevelopment. Activity is visible across the tri-tower complex, where Hard Rock is reconfiguring rooms, casino space, and back-of-house areas to align with the brand's design standards.
24/7 Construction Schedule in Effect
Hard Rock has shifted to a continuous 24/7 construction schedule, with crews working day and night to maintain momentum toward the resort's planned late-2027 opening. The around-the-clock pace reflects the dual challenge of building a new 42-story tower while simultaneously renovating the existing resort footprint.
Project Remains on Schedule
Despite the scale of the redevelopment, Hard Rock continues to target a late-2027 opening, and current progress aligns with that timeline. With the structural frame complete and facade installation accelerating, the project has moved into the most visually transformative phase of construction.
